Vue移动端UI框架大盘点_易于使用_关注更新和维护选择长期维护和更新的框架
Vue移动端UI框架大盘点
一、Vant
Vant是专门为Vue.js设计的移动端UI框架,由有赞团队开发。它的特点如下:
- 丰富的组件:提供按钮、弹出框、表单等多种组件。
- 易于使用:简洁的API和详细的文档。
- 高性能:优化过的组件在移动设备上流畅运行。
- 活跃社区:提供及时支持和帮助。
主要组件:
组件名称 | 描述 |
---|---|
Button | 按钮组件,支持多种样式和状态 |
Popup | 弹出层组件,支持多种弹出方式 |
Form | 表单组件,支持表单验证 |
Tab | 选项卡组件,支持多种样式 |
二、Mint UI
Mint UI是由饿了么团队开发的一款轻量级Vue组件库。主要特点如下:
- 轻量级:体积小巧,加载速度快。
- 高可定制性:提供多种主题和样式。
- 易于集成:与Vue无缝集成,使用方便。
- 稳定性:经过大规模项目验证。
主要组件:
组件名称 | 描述 |
---|---|
Loadmore | 下拉刷新和加载更多组件 |
Swipe | 轮播图组件,支持多种效果 |
Picker | 选择器组件,支持多级联动 |
Navbar | 导航栏组件,支持多种样式 |
三、Framework7-Vue
Framework7-Vue是一个功能强大的移动端框架,支持Vue.js。主要特点如下:
- 全面的UI组件:提供导航、视图切换、对话框等组件。
- 丰富的功能:支持拖拽、手势操作、动画效果等。
- 高性能:经过优化,性能卓越。
- 多平台支持:支持Web端和原生应用。
主要组件:
组件名称 | 描述 |
---|---|
View | 视图组件,支持视图切换 |
List | 列表组件,支持多种样式 |
Popup | 弹出层组件,支持多种弹出方式 |
Toolbar | 工具栏组件,支持多种样式 |
四、Cube UI
Cube UI是滴滴团队开发的一款基于Vue.js的移动端组件库。主要特点如下:
- 精美的设计:符合现代移动端设计规范。
- 高可用性:提供丰富的组件和功能。
- 易于使用:提供详细的文档和示例。
- 高性能:经过优化,性能良好。
主要组件:
组件名称 | 描述 |
---|---|
Button | 按钮组件,支持多种样式和状态 |
Slide | 轮播图组件,支持多种效果 |
Dialog | 对话框组件,支持多种样式 |
Scroll | 滚动组件,支持下拉刷新和加载更多 |
在选择Vue移动端UI框架时,需根据项目需求和团队情况进行选择。Vant适合丰富组件支持的项目,Mint UI适合追求轻量级和快速开发的项目,Framework7-Vue适合构建复杂和高性能的移动端应用,而Cube UI则在设计和高可用性方面表现出色。
进一步建议:
- 评估项目需求:选择能满足开发需求的框架。
- 试用不同框架:评估使用体验和性能。
- 查看社区支持:选择拥有活跃社区支持的框架。
- 关注更新和维护:选择长期维护和更新的框架。